当前位置: 首页 > news >正文

任县网站制作100 款软件app免费下载大全

任县网站制作,100 款软件app免费下载大全,一个网站的建设需要什么时候开始,做好网站建设的重要性以下是关于 Apache HBase 安装、配置以及简单操作的详细指南: HBase 简介 Apache HBase 是一个基于 Hadoop 的分布式数据库,擅长处理大规模、结构化的海量数据。它采用行列式存储方式,与 Hadoop 和 HDFS 紧密结合,是支持大数据实…

以下是关于 Apache HBase 安装、配置以及简单操作的详细指南:


HBase 简介

Apache HBase 是一个基于 Hadoop 的分布式数据库,擅长处理大规模、结构化的海量数据。它采用行列式存储方式,与 Hadoop 和 HDFS 紧密结合,是支持大数据实时读写操作的数据库系统。

第一部分:HBase 的安装与配置

1. 前提条件

HBase 依赖 Hadoop 和 Zookeeper 服务来运行,因此在安装 HBase 之前,需要确保 Hadoop 和 Zookeeper 已经安装并正确配置。

2. 下载 HBase

从 Apache HBase 官网下载 HBase 的最新稳定版本,将下载的文件解压并移动到合适的目录中。例如:

tar -zxvf hbase-x.x.x-bin.tar.gz
mv hbase-x.x.x /usr/local/hbase
3. 配置 HBase

在 HBase 安装目录下的 conf/hbase-site.xml 文件中添加基本的配置内容:

<configuration><property><name>hbase.rootdir</name><value>hdfs://localhost:9000/hbase</value></property><property><name>hbase.zookeeper.property.dataDir</name><value>/usr/local/zookeeper</value></property>
</configuration>

配置说明:

  • hbase.rootdir:指定 HBase 数据的根目录,可以是本地文件路径或 HDFS 路径。
  • hbase.zookeeper.property.dataDir:Zookeeper 数据存储的路径。
4. 配置环境变量

将 HBase 路径加入到环境变量中,以便直接调用 HBase 命令。编辑 .bashrc.zshrc 文件:

export HBASE_HOME=/usr/local/hbase
export PATH=$PATH:$HBASE_HOME/bin

然后刷新配置文件:

source ~/.bashrc
5. 启动 HBase

进入 HBase 的安装目录,使用以下命令启动 HBase:

start-hbase.sh

访问 http://localhost:16010 查看 HBase 的管理界面,确认 HBase 服务是否成功启动。

第二部分:基本操作(通过 HBase Shell)

HBase 提供了交互式 Shell,方便执行常见的数据库操作。启动 HBase Shell:

hbase shell

在 Shell 中可以执行以下操作:

1. 创建表
create 'my_table', 'cf'

创建名为 my_table 的表,其中 cf 是列族名。

2. 插入数据
put 'my_table', 'row1', 'cf:col1', 'value1'

my_table 表中插入一行数据,行键为 row1,列族 cf 下的 col1 列,值为 value1

3. 读取数据
get 'my_table', 'row1'

获取 my_table 表中行键为 row1 的所有数据。

4. 扫描表
scan 'my_table'

扫描并返回 my_table 表中的所有行数据。

5. 删除数据
delete 'my_table', 'row1', 'cf:col1'

删除 my_table 表中行键 row1cf:col1 列的数据。

6. 删除表

在删除表之前,必须禁用该表:

disable 'my_table'
drop 'my_table'

第三部分:集群配置(可选)

在生产环境中,HBase 通常会配置为集群模式。以下是简单的集群配置思路:

1. 配置 HBase Master 和 RegionServer

conf/ 目录下找到 regionservers 文件,添加 RegionServer 节点 IP 或主机名。

2. 配置 Zookeeper 集群

hbase-site.xml 中添加 Zookeeper 的主机列表:

<property><name>hbase.zookeeper.quorum</name><value>zk1,zk2,zk3</value>
</property>
3. 启动集群

在 Master 节点运行 start-hbase.sh 命令,HBase 将启动并连接至配置好的 Zookeeper 集群。

常见问题

  • HDFS 配置问题:如果 HBase 使用 HDFS 存储数据,确保 HDFS 正常运行。
  • 网络连接问题:确保 HBase Master、RegionServer 和 Zookeeper 之间的网络连接正常。
  • 权限问题:如果遇到权限错误,检查文件和目录权限。

总结

完成以上步骤后,你已经成功安装并配置了 HBase,能够进行基本的数据操作。对于更高级的操作,可以深入研究 HBase 的 API 和集群管理策略。

http://www.yayakq.cn/news/69386/

相关文章:

  • seo站长工具综合查询家具设计师招聘
  • 网页美工素材百家港 seo服务
  • 怎么做网站子页wordpress new2主题使用
  • 常见的网站首页布局有哪几种做网站都需要哪些软件
  • 静态做网站德州做网站的公司
  • 顺德网站开发企业建设网站好吗
  • 网站ico怎么用网站建设的比较合理的流程
  • 网站建设犭金手指六六壹柒江都区城乡建设局网站马局
  • 建设网站的风险管理开源网站建设实习心得
  • 简述网站推广的方法管理咨询公司是做什么
  • 安装安全狗网站打不开万能视频下载工具
  • 英文域名在哪个网站查询dede 两个网站图片路径
  • 做商城网站哪个好产品推广方式
  • 泰安网站建设公司带广州做seo整站优化公司
  • 做电商网站前端的技术选型是软件定制合同
  • react做网站天津建设网站哪家好
  • 微山县建设局官方网站为什么wordpress安装成了英文版
  • 怎么做直播视频教学视频网站丽水建设网站
  • 做网站备案地点哪个网站 可以做快递单录入
  • 怎样做代刷网站先做网站后备案
  • 毕业设计做 什么网站好html5手机网站开发框架
  • 经营网站如何挣钱中国美食网站模板免费下载
  • 扬州建设银行网站九幺seo优化神器
  • 山东建设厅官方网站孙松青网站建设关键词布局
  • 徐州手机网站开发公司免费聊天软件
  • 17做网店网站东莞网站建设 少儿托管
  • 数据服务网站开发wordpress静态加速
  • 网站如何添加代码网站建设与维护 实训
  • 银川网站建设哪家便宜上饶市建设局网站百代
  • 珠海网站推广公司wordpress主题开发出